| Method of referring |
Children must be 14 years and under to be seen as a new referral, existing patients may be referred until 16 years of age.
Referral Including: Reason for referral, child's DOB, investigations already undertaken and results, family contact details and Medicare number. The referral should be addressed to the specialist by name (areas of specialty below). It should then be faxed to the Orthopaedic Outpatient's Clinic on 9845 2702. These will be assessed in order of urgency and priority and an appointment will be sent to the patient / family in the mail.
If a referral is felt to be a high priority the medical officer should, after faxing the referral, contact Corinne Bridge 98450000 (page number 6966) to discuss the referral.
